如何提高精准翻译软件的翻译效率?
随着全球化进程的不断加快,翻译在各个领域都扮演着越来越重要的角色。精准翻译软件作为翻译行业的重要工具,其翻译效率直接影响到翻译质量。如何提高精准翻译软件的翻译效率,成为业界关注的焦点。本文将从以下几个方面探讨提高精准翻译软件翻译效率的方法。
一、优化算法
采用先进的机器翻译算法:目前,主流的机器翻译算法有基于统计的机器翻译(SMT)和基于神经网络的机器翻译(NMT)。SMT算法在处理长句和复杂句子方面具有一定的优势,而NMT算法在处理短句和简单句子方面表现较好。因此,可以根据翻译任务的特点选择合适的算法。
优化翻译模型:通过不断优化翻译模型,提高翻译质量。例如,在NMT模型中,可以通过调整注意力机制、循环神经网络(RNN)等模块,提高模型对源语言和目标语言的语义理解能力。
引入多语言资源:将多种语言资源(如双语语料库、平行语料库等)整合到翻译模型中,丰富模型的知识储备,提高翻译质量。
二、提升语料库质量
增加高质量语料库:收集更多高质量的语料库,为翻译模型提供更多训练数据。高质量语料库应具备以下特点:真实、多样、全面。
优化语料库结构:对语料库进行清洗、去重、标注等处理,提高语料库的质量。例如,可以采用词性标注、命名实体识别等技术,对语料库进行结构化处理。
引入多领域语料库:针对不同领域的翻译任务,引入相应的领域语料库,提高翻译的准确性。
三、提高翻译速度
并行处理:利用多核处理器、分布式计算等技术,实现翻译任务的并行处理,提高翻译速度。
优化翻译流程:简化翻译流程,减少不必要的步骤,提高翻译效率。例如,在翻译过程中,可以采用预翻译、后翻译等技术,减少翻译时间。
引入云翻译服务:利用云计算技术,将翻译任务分发到云端,实现大规模并行处理,提高翻译速度。
四、提高翻译质量
引入人工干预:在翻译过程中,引入人工干预,对翻译结果进行校对和修改,提高翻译质量。
建立翻译质量评估体系:通过建立翻译质量评估体系,对翻译结果进行量化评估,为翻译模型的优化提供依据。
持续优化翻译模型:根据翻译质量评估结果,不断优化翻译模型,提高翻译质量。
五、降低翻译成本
优化翻译资源配置:根据翻译任务的特点,合理配置翻译资源,降低翻译成本。
引入翻译自动化工具:利用翻译自动化工具,如机器翻译、机器校对等,降低人工翻译成本。
推广开源翻译软件:鼓励使用开源翻译软件,降低翻译成本。
总之,提高精准翻译软件的翻译效率需要从多个方面入手。通过优化算法、提升语料库质量、提高翻译速度、提高翻译质量以及降低翻译成本,可以有效地提高精准翻译软件的翻译效率,为翻译行业的发展提供有力支持。
猜你喜欢:软件本地化翻译